'Race 3' cast not yet decided; script work on, says producer

The makers of "Race 3" say work on the third installment is in progress and promised the film will be grander and bigger than the first two parts in terms of style and action.
"Race" is a series of action-thriller films with great story plot, stylised action sequences, lust, love and exotic locations. Both "Race" and "Race 2", directed by Abbas Mustan, have done well commercially.
"We are working on the script with our team writers. In two-three months we should be ready. The film might go on floors this year or early next year," Kumar Taurani, producer of "Race" series, told PTI.
Both the films have had an ensemble cast but apart from Anil Kapoor and Saif Ali Khan the entire cast have been different.
Asked about the actors in "Race 3", he said "casting depends on script. It is too early to talk whether any of the actors would be repeated in the third part or not."
Besides "Race 3", Taurani also plans to turn 1998 hit film "Soldier" into a franchise. The action-thriller, directed by Abbas-Mustan and produced by Taurani, had Raakhee, Bobby Deol and Preity Zinta in the lead.
"Soldier has a great story line which can be taken ahead with Girish (Taurani's actor son). We are yet to zero in on the story (for the second installment," Taurani said.
